Applying for courses

Studies in the Finnish online university of applied sciences are free of charge for students of universities of applied sciences as part of their degree studies.

By logging in to the portal and entering the Study Services you will be able to search for the courses currently available. When you find a course that interests you, first check with your university whether you can include it in your studies.

Steps to fill in an electronic application


In the Study Services, when you choose Course Supply, a new search window will appear that enables you to find courses that interest you. To apply, double click the title of the course in the box below, and an electronic application form appears on the right. Check the box "I agree to carry out the course if I will get the study right". In the Motivations field, explain why you want to attend this course. Also define whether you want to include the course in your basic, vocational, or optional studies. If you have agreed attending this course with a teacher in your own university of applied sciences, also check the box "Arranged with the teacher". Then click the Send button to send your application forward.

Then you can start following the application process. Within two weeks of the end of the enrolment, your application will be processed by both your home university and the university in charge of the course.

Following the application process

You can follow the advance of your applications in the Own Applications section of the Study Services.

If your application is Waiting for support, your university of applied sciences has not yet processed it. If it is Waiting for receiving university's acceptance, your application has been supported by your home university but is still waiting to be processed in the university in charge of the course. When your application has been processed by both universities, you will see it either under Accepted on the course section or in the Rejected applications. You will also receive an e-mail message that will be sent to the address you have given when registering to the portal.

You can cancel your application until the end of the enrolment period. Until then, you can also supplement your motivations.
